Esther Morse, 92, of Fort Madison, fell into the arms of God on Saturday, Aug. 19, 2023.  She was born Sept. 20, 1930, in Brighton, Colo., a daughter of John and Mary Bitter Ells.  On May 6, 1952, she married Charlie Martin Morse at Fort Madison.  He preceded her in death May 30, 2015.

She was a homemaker.  For 25 years, she worked as a nurse's aide at the former Fort Madison Community Hospital.  She enjoyed gardening, embroidery, sewing, and traveling.  She was a member of the Seventh-Day Adventist Church.

Esther was a loving mother and grandmother.  She is survived by her six children; Charlotte Fraise, of North Dakota; Rebecca (Ronald Jr.) Leffler, Tennessee;  Linda King (Bruce Scott), of Georgia; Steven (Esther) Morse, of Panama; Rose (Bruce) Bohnenkamp, of Iowa; and Sheila Morse, Colorado; 10 grandchildren; Spencer Fraise, Adam Fraise, Ronald Leffler III, Heather Leffler, Barry King II, Benjamin King, Joey Morse, Jennie Inger, Emily McPeak, and Alexander Bohnenkamp; many great-grandchildren and one great-great-granddaughter.  She was preceded in death by her parents, husband, five brothers, four sisters, one granddaughter Melissa Leffler, and one daughter-in-law Julie Morse.
